Ingredients You'll Need

12-18 frozen dinner rolls
1 stick of butter
1/2 cup of brown sugar
1 package of butterscotch instant pudding mix
1 tsp of cinnamon
1/2 cup of pecans


Directions

Sprinkle the instant pudding mix in the bottom of a bunt pan and then place the defrosted dinner rolls in the bunt pan


Melt the butter and brown sugar in a pan over the stove and then pour it over the dinner rolls. Let this sit over night.


Bake the next morning at 350 degrees for 20-30 minutes


After it is done, wait 5 minutes and then dump the rolls out of the pan.


ENJOY!
